掌握NX软件二次开发:UF_FACET_ask_vertices_of_facet函数详解
需积分: 1 26 浏览量
更新于2024-10-25
收藏 4KB ZIP 举报
资源摘要信息:"NX二次开发UF-FACET-ask-vertices-of-facet函数介绍"
NX是西门子PLM软件公司推出的一款高端计算机辅助设计(CAD)、计算机辅助制造(CAM)、计算机辅助工程(CAE)软件产品,广泛应用于汽车、航空航天、机械制造等领域。二次开发是指在原有软件的基础上进行定制化的开发,以满足特定的业务需求。NX提供了丰富的API(Application Programming Interface,应用程序编程接口),供开发者使用,从而实现软件功能的自动化、定制化和扩展。
UF是NX软件中的一个编程接口模块,全称为Unigraphics,它是NX软件二次开发的基础,开发者可以通过UF提供的API函数,编写程序来实现特定的功能。其中,UF_FACET_ask_vertices_of_facet函数是UF中用于查询多面体元素顶点位置的函数,这个函数允许用户获取多面体表面元素的所有顶点坐标信息。
在机械设计、制造、模具设计、逆向工程、CAE分析等领域,准确获取模型表面的细节信息是至关重要的。在某些情况下,可能需要从多面体模型中直接获取顶点信息以用于特定的分析、测量或其他操作。通过该函数,用户可以准确地从多面体元素中提取出顶点信息,从而对模型进行更深入的分析和处理。
在二次开发过程中,使用UF_FACET_ask_vertices_of_facet函数,开发者需要熟悉NX的API文档和相应的数据结构。通常,函数会返回一个顶点列表,开发者可以依据这个列表进行进一步的处理。例如,可以将这些顶点信息用于自动化脚本中,以编程方式生成新的模型元素,或进行复杂的数据分析和仿真。
使用这些API函数,可以极大地提高工作效率,减轻重复性工作带来的负担,同时也增强了工作流程的灵活性和可扩展性。无论是专业工程师还是普通用户,通过二次开发都能够在使用NX软件时获得更加强大和便捷的体验。
此外,Ufun还提供了丰富的帮助文档和示例代码,帮助用户快速上手和熟悉API的使用。这些资源不仅包含了函数的详细说明,还有大量实用的编程范例,使用户能够快速地掌握如何利用这些API来实现具体的功能。
总而言之,通过NX的二次开发,尤其是利用UF_FACET_ask_vertices_of_facet等API函数,用户可以获得强大的工具来扩展和优化自己的工作流程,实现从手动操作到自动化、智能化的转变。这些功能不仅限于专业领域的应用,还能够帮助普通用户通过脚本和程序自动化完成日常任务,从而提升整体的工作效率和生产力。
2024-07-03 上传
2024-07-03 上传
2024-07-03 上传
2024-07-01 上传
2024-07-01 上传
2024-07-03 上传
2024-07-01 上传
2024-07-03 上传
2024-07-01 上传
王牌飞行员_里海
- 粉丝: 3w+
- 资源: 1742
最新资源
- amazing-graph
- jQuery等高排列插件matchHeight
- homework06
- 计算机科学工程:在米兰理工大学攻读工程学,计算机科学工程学士学位和硕士学位,所有课程及其材料的集合
- Snow:php包将json内容从Editor.js转换为html元素
- BoardgameInventorySystem:个人项目,使用Java为棋盘游戏收藏创建库存系统
- 天气仪表板
- 小黄帽flash动画儿歌
- 关于JSP网上订餐系统本科论文有源码MSQ、JSP
- php程序设计课程大作业——基于PHP、MySQL的web端借还书系统.zip
- blog.cms
- variable Size & Position-crx插件
- roundcube_syncmarks:在Roundcube中显示Firefox书签
- jsroot:JavaScript 根
- r8152-2.14.0
- Advanced Simulation Library:免费的多物理场仿真软件包-开源